About Converting Grains per Tablespoon to Decigrams per Liter
Grain per Tablespoon and Decigram per Liter both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.
Formula
decigrams per liter = grains per tablespoon × 43.8222362759
This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 grain per tablespoon equals 4.38222362759 base units, and 1 decigram per liter equals 0.1 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ct grain per tablespoon-to-decigram per liter factor of 43.8222362759.

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?
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
